This Saturday, at the O2 Arena, in London, two heavyweights who are destined to fight each other in December, both fight on the bill.

Anthony Joshua tops the bill in a fight for the Commonwealth heavyweight title. In an intriguing match-up Joshua comes face-to-face with Gary Cornish, with both fighters being unbeaten.

Joshua has recorded 13 straight wins (all inside three rounds) whilst Cornish has a record that reads 21-0 with 12 of those wins coming by the big knockout.

Further down the bill Dillian Whyte takes on Brian Minto, Whyte is also unbeaten with a record that reads 15-0 with 12 coming by way of knockout whilst the more experienced Minto has a record that reads 41-9 with 26 coming by way of knockout.

Here at Vital Boxing we expect both fighters to win keeping their December date on schedule, Joshua might be extended past round three but his explosive power will tell.

Whyte will also win and will want to look good as he heads towards a showdown that he believes will see him beat Joshua a second time, the first time being in the amateur ranks.

At the weigh-in for the promotion, held today, Whyte and Joshua had to be pulled apart as they traded insults, for me December can?t come quick enough.
